My Recycle Bin - Recovering deleted documents

Deleted documents are placed in a special location in infoRouter called the Recycle Bin.

Every infoRouter user has a unique recycle bin that keeps the documents that have been deleted by that user.

infoRouter users can only see the contents of their own recycle bin however, the system administrator can search through every recycle bin to recover documents.

If one of your documents is deleted by another user, only the user who deleted this document or the System Administrator can recover this document.

Depending on the choice of the System Administrator, you may be able to empty your Recycle Bin. If this option is turned on, you will see a button labeled "Empty Recycle Bin".

If you delete a document and wish to recover it, perform the following:

  1. Click on the "My Recycle Bin" link under my profile
  2. recycle bin menu
  3. This will launch the "Recycle Bin" window which will display all the documents you have deleted.
  4. recycle bin list
  5. Select the document you wish to recover and click on the "Restore" link.
  6. You will be prompted for a folder to restore the deleted document.
  7. Select a folder and confirm your action.

The document will be restored with all its original information including its versions.

Warning: If you empty your recycle bin, your documents will still be recoverable becuase they will be moved into the system recycle bin. The system recycle bin can only be accessed by the system administrator or members of the administrators system user group.
